BEER AND HEALT CARE
All our beers are produced using natural methods, without additives, not pasteurized or sorted, avoiding in this way to remove most of the aromatic substances present, making a careful product to consumer health. In fact, the beers produced are characterized by a high presence of B vitamins (including folic acid, useful for the absorption of iron in the blood) of natural antioxidants such as polyphenols and natural yeasts that help the intestine and prevent the feeling bloated. The fermentation process used is that of high fermentation with selected yeast strains. We provide raw materials from top-quality and experienced suppliers. Much care and attention is paid to the choice of hops using those pellets and flower. The beers after a first fermentation and subsequent maturation in fermenters / tank, move to a second fermentation,n in the bottle by a special technique.

HOP
Its function is to stretch the foam, to clarify the mixture of malt and water, preventing the proliferation of bacteria that spoil or ruin the conservation and also gives the beer its characteristic bitter taste that.
WATER
The water represents 95% of the beer and affects the taste and the production process.
YEAST
It is the last element to be added, giving more flavor and is essential for fermentation (high fermentation process for our beers).
BARLEY
It is the main element in the production of beer. The barley is transformed by the malt. The mixture of the various and different types of malt give substance to the beer, while its color characterizes the final product: the beer.

The icon of the Bug Beer is a stylized hop reminiscent of an insect. The term Bug, in fact, literally translated means "little bug" and is used in computer jargon to indicate programming anomalies, unexpected behavior or at least different from the usual ones.
Away from the routine of industrial beer. Ready to meet the ambitious and sophisticated tastes of true connoisseurs, but also of those who make a beer mug a simple moment of socialization.
BUG BEER
In 1947, an insect introduced himself into a personal computer, causing unexpected results, 70 years after the Bug Beer breaks into the world of craft beers proposing a different drink, easy to drink, smooth, simple, but not trivial.
The idea to start the craft brewing born in 2012, brainchild by some founders, fans in the industry, who have started using "homemade" methods, such as plastic fermenter.
The beer produced, according to the tasters friends, was not so “buggy”, but for years the idea to market this project, was stopped at home. The beer was just a hobby. Produce it looked like something crazy and absurd that it remains a utopia.
Only recently, thanks and through the strong constitution of "Bug Beer Co. ', and most of all with the collaboration of a friend with a high experience in homebrewer,( the alchemist who puts his soul into the beer it produces), and of course a professional taster U.D.B. by 2015 it was decided to realize this dream, bringing it to reality. Entering in a serious and professional market.
The enthusiasm and skills are not lacking. The project is to propose a craft beer that leads the consumer to enjoy the taste of drinking well and natural.
Bug Beer is a Beer Firm. The beers are produced, following our recipes, at the Birrificio Irpino di Avellino and the Birrificio Lievito e Nuvole of Avella (Av)
